« Reply #20 on: May 18, 2010 »

 ;D We did, but were late leaving so tidy was out. Boys climbed out on mud and sank.... so we canoed round to Killyleagh side where you camped and got ashore there. When they said mudflats, I didn't realise just how much mud and how far out it went. Couldn't get near the Bothy pier at all until tidy was in.

I don't think you necessarily are allowed in the plantation, but I need to check that. We were far enough away from the bothy not to be of concern to the people there and the trees elsewhere were no use for hammocks.
